Kobe Bryant and the wife he’s divorcing after 10 years, Vanessa, were seen kissing courtside at his LA Lakers basketball game on Valentine’s Day. (More photos are here.) This leads to inevitable reconciliation talk despite the fact that Vanessa has already filed for divorce and the property settlement has already been finalized. Vanessa got a whopping $75 million, basically half of Kobe’s earnings, plus all three of their massive estates, but their divorce is not finished yet and could be potentially be withdrawn. Another come-from-behind victory for Kobe Bryant … sucking face with the woman who has now taken all of his homes, Vanessa Bryant … and now TMZ can confirm the two are working on a reconciliation.

Vanessa showed up for the Lakers Valentine’s Day victory over the Atlanta Hawks. The two shared a kiss in the tunnel on the way into the locker room.

TMZ broke the story … Vanessa filed for divorce in December, and they have already sealed the property settlement deal in which Vanessa got all 3 Newport Beach estates.

But sources told us at the time Vanessa filed … don’t be surprised if she goes back to Bryant.

And, although Kobe and Vanessa have submitted all the necessary docs to divorce, it doesn’t become final until mid-June, so there’s plenty of time to withdraw the papers.

FYI — we’re told Kobe and Vanessa are NOT living with each other … yet.
